Turmeric is widely studied for its health-promoting properties. It has been used in Traditional Chinese Medicine, as well as Ayurvedic medicine, for more than 2,000 years. Curcumin is turmeric’s most active component and provides numerous health benefits, including support for joint function and mobility, liver and gut health, cardiovascular function. Curcumin is also a potent antioxidant.* 

Because curcumin supports a healthy inflammatory response it is beneficial for anyone experiencing the bodily discomforts of life.* Curcumin can provide relief for overused muscles and joints.* In addition, maintaining a healthy inflammatory response is essential to healthy joints, muscles, brain, eyes, and blood lipids.* 

Thorne’s Curcumin Phytosome, as Meriva, is the most clinically-studied curcumin on the market and, as a phytosome complex it provides superior absorption over other curcumin extracts. A human study demonstrated 29-times greater absorption of Meriva than ordinary curcumin.

+ What does a typical treatment look like?

Your first visit (and once a year) is always a full chiropractic exam which includes taking a thorough health history, performing various orthopedic and neurological exams to assess your baseline and deciding on a treatment plan that feels like a good fit according to exam results. I will make recommendations based on exam findings and together we will figure out what might work best for you going forward. After any needed therapies, I will assess the motion and restrictions within the spine and extremities, do some light muscle work and percussion massage and then move into adjustments. Ultimately, you are in charge of your care in the clinic. I will make recommendations and if at any point you feel uncomfortable or want any part of the treatment to stop, you are always fully empowered to let me know and I will work with you to find a way to adjust and treat that is suitable and comfortable for you. 
 You should allow about an hour for the first treatment, although it typically takes less time. Every visit moving forward will be about 20-30 minutes and will consist of any elective therapies as well as a much shorter spinal exam and adjustment.
